3.18. Determining volumes of investment powder and water for
Investment
determining amount of powder per flask this formula is helpful:
Volume of flask in ccm x 1,4 = amount of powder in grams
For example flask ø 8 x 8 cm
x x h x 1,6 = amount of investment powder in g
4² x 3,14 x 8 x 1,4 = 570 g
Or on flasks ø 5 x 5,5 cm
2,5² x x 5,5 x 1,4 = 150 g
This is gross weight, volume of cone and wax pieces must be subtracted!
To find out proper the amount of water according to the instruction manual of
investment material:
Ratio, given by instructions: 100:40
100:40 = 570:x
40 x 643:100 = x = 228 g water
Please take notice:
More water makes investment material more permeable for gases = better form
filling. If the manufacturer gives a mixing ratio 37 .. 39 : 100, use for filigree items
39:100, on standard items use 37:100!
Make very precise measurement, use water with exact 20°C Too cold or too warm
water can strongly change properties of the investment material like mixing time etc.
